Community Garden Education Classes on basic orchid care introduce participants to the unique needs of these elegant and often misunderstood plants. The class begins by demystifying common orchid varieties, such as Phalaenopsis and Dendrobium, and explaining how their natural habitats influence their care requirements. Learners discover how to choose the right potting medium, typically bark or sphagnum moss, which allows for proper airflow around the roots. Instructors emphasize the importance of indirect light, consistent but moderate watering, and good drainage to prevent root rot. The session also covers how to recognize signs of stress, such as yellowing leaves or shriveled roots, and how to address these issues before they worsen. Participants gain confidence in techniques like repotting, fertilizing with balanced orchid nutrients, and encouraging reblooming after the flowering cycle. By the end of the class, gardeners understand that with the right knowledge and routine care, orchids can thrive and bloom beautifully, adding color and serenity to both home and community garden spaces.
